I can understand your frustration. I worked in the film industry in Toronto for over 30 years. In my career, I worked on many commercial shoots with the various production companies. We never relied on cooling to create condensation drops on products, as this method was too unreliable and very hit and miss. The prop masters always used glycerin, available at your local pharmacy, to create perfect, tears, sweat, condensation on cans and bottles, and create the illusion of a perfectly grilled burger.
